Trials of Mana 25th Anniversary Update and Discounts

Trials of Mana, known as Seiken Densetsu 3 in Japan, celebrates its 25th anniversary. To celebrate the occasion, the developers are releasing a new update,  including Zoom backgrounds and a price slash on digital versions of the game. The patch will contain a new difficulty level that will challenge veteran players. After completing it, you will receive new equipment.

Trials of Mana Patch 1.1.0

Trials of Mana

This new patch will introduce the “No Future” Difficulty. This mode will test the most experienced Trials of Mana fans. The boss fights will have a time limit, enemies and bosses are stronger, and restrictions on abilities and item usage are in place. To compensate, players can have stronger equipment and can execute new chain abilities.

Hardened and veteran Trials of Mana players who complete the game in the “No Future” difficulty will be rewarded with “Rabite Slippers”. This new equipment that you can see on the image above will let the player roam fields and dungeons without encountering enemies. For those who want to play the “New Game Plus” mode, you now have the option to choose “Expert” difficulty. An option to revert characters to level 1 is also added. Costumes can now be accessed on “New Game Plus” or after resetting a character’s class too. All in all, some solid difficulties and refinements.

Digital Discounts and Zoom Backgrounds

To continue the celebration, Square Enix is slashing the price of the game’s digital copies. Other Mana titles are also at discounted prices.

  • Trials of Mana at a 30% discount
    • Nintendo Switch
    • PlayStation 4
    • Steam
  • Secret of Mana at a 50% discount
    • PlayStation 4
    • Steam
  • Collection of Mana at a 50% discount
    • Nintendo Switch

Trials of Mana or Seiken Densetsu 3 in Japan was released in 1995. This third entry to the classic JRPG Mana series was given a full, high-definition remake later on. It surpassed Square Enix’s sales expectations even though it was released right after the Final Fantasy VII Remake, which is no small feat.
